Output 84bff86837610dc852d771618ea5ea48bb1f4108e5497d6562c0b63b7d4aa4c1:3

value
545784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664af9280d55a87ec2e544dc5865937cd7c4e901 OP_EQUAL
address
3B1tfLvp6bGLCsEPYFWBq1MQXPHzbesmSr
transaction
84bff86837610dc852d771618ea5ea48bb1f4108e5497d6562c0b63b7d4aa4c1
spent
true